Learn More ». Breakfast fruit smoothies are always a crowd-pleasing choice. Strawberries and blueberries are my go-tos. Bananas make smoothies naturally sweet. Mango and pineapple can hide the taste of greens. Unexpected fruits like apples or watermelon can be scrumptious too. Vegetables . Spinach, kale, avocado, carrots, and even beets can all be added to smoothies. . Spinach, kale, avocado, carrots, and even beets can all be added to smoothies. Flavor Additions . Vanilla, cinnamon, honey, maple syrup, and dates are all excellent ways to give your smoothie more flavor. . Vanilla, cinnamon, honey, maple syrup, and dates are all excellent ways to give your smoothie more flavor. Liquid. Unsweetened almond milk is my favorite for smoothies. You can also use juice (be sure to do this in moderation, since juice is high in sugar but low in fiber), a different kind of milk, coconut water, or even plain water. Are Breakfast Smoothies Good for Weight Loss? Filling breakfast smoothies that are high in protein and low in calories can be good for weight loss. Choosing hearty breakfast smoothies will help make sure you aren’t starving by mid-morning. See the Healthy Breakfast Smoothies for Weight Loss category below for recipe ideas.
